A Mini Oscilloscope Clock made with a 2AP1A CRT cathode ray tube. The board has pots to adjust vertical horizontal height / width , focus, astigmatism, brightness, and centering.
Homemade, not a commercial product. Display also moves slightly every six seconds to help prevent burn in of the crt. The clear acrylic shroud and Plexiglas's base are homemade. The display alternates every ten seconds between digital and analog style.
